LPB is at the halfway of the Regular Season and there are still another 5 rounds left. Here is the last round review presented by LBM Management.

The most exciting game was a derby match between two local teams from Panama City: LA U (#4) and Aguilas (#3). LA U (3-3) crushed visiting Aguilas (2-3) by 17 points 69-52. LA U forced 27 Aguilas turnovers. Swingman Diobelis Batista (167-5) orchestrated the victory by scoring 19 points, 9 rebounds, 8 assists and 6 steals. Guard Mariangel Concha (-4) contributed with 19 points and 10 rebounds for the winners. Center Angelica Racine answered with a double-double by scoring 18 points, 14 rebounds and 5 assists for Aguilas. Both coaches used bench players which allowed the starters a little rest for the next games. LA U moved-up to third place. Aguilas at the other side dropped to the fourth position with three games lost. LA U's supporters look forward to another derby game next round, where their team will face at home their local rival from Panama City Panteras.
An interesting game for Correcaminos (5-0) which played road game in Panama City against second-ranked Panteras (4-2). Leader Correcaminos managed to get a 7-point victory 66-59. It ended at the same time the four-game winning streak of Panteras. Colombian forward Mabel Martinez (180-86) stepped up with a double-double by scoring 22 points, 20 rebounds and 5 assists for the winners and Tathiana Mosquera chipped in 20 points, 7 rebounds and 7 assists. Power forward Maria de Gracia responded with a double-double by scoring 13 points and 14 rebounds. Both coaches tested many bench players and allowed the starting five to rest. Undefeated Correcaminos have an impressive series of five victories in a row. Defending champion maintains first place with 5-0 record. Panteras at the other side keep the second position with two games lost. Correcaminos will play against bottom-ranked Atletico (#6) in Panama City in the next round which should be theoretically an easy game. Panteras' supporters look forward to an exciting derby game next round, where their team will travel locally in Panama City to the arena LA U.

In the last game of round 5 bottom-ranked Atletico was beaten by Amazonas on the road 84-70.
The most impressive performance of 5th round was 16 points and 26 rebounds by Gloria Martinez of Amazonas.

Amazonas - Atletico 84-70

Everything could happen in Cocle at the game between two tied teams. Both fifth ranked Amazonas and 6th ranked Atletico had identical 1-4 record. This time Amazonas used a home court advantage and beat the opponent from Panama City 84-70. Amazonas outrebounded Atletico 76-41 including a 32-10 advantage in offensive rebounds. Atletico was plagued by 31 personal fouls down the stretch. Colombian forward Laura Garrido (-90) stepped up with a double-double by scoring 40 points (!!!), 15 rebounds, 4 assists and 4 steals for the winners and guard Gloria Martinez chipped in 16 points and 26 rebounds. Venezuelan point guard Nathaly Malpica (161) responded with 21 points and 9 rebounds and Soleimar Martinez produced a double-double by scoring 11 points, 11 rebounds and 4 assists. Atletico's coach rotated eleven players saving starting five for next games. Amazonas maintains fifth place with 2-4 record. Atletico lost their fourth game in a row. They stay at the bottom position with five games lost. Amazonas will play against higher ranked Aguilas (#4) in Panama City in the next round and it will be quite challenging to get another victory. Atletico will play at home against the league's leader Correcaminos to get more than just one victory in their record.
